Calgary 4 Vancouver 3 (OT)
Johnny Gaudreau scored 23 seconds into overtime for the (8-6-1) Flames. The (7-11-1) Canucks got a point when Brock Boeser tallied with 30 seconds left in the 3rd period. The same teams meet again Wednesday in Calgary.

NBA:
The (12-15) Toronto Raptors visit the (16-11) Milwaukee Bucks tonight and Thursday and Minnesota on Friday before hosting Philadelphia on Sunday in Tampa. The Raptors are coming off Sunday’s 116-112 loss to Minnesota.
